Hyundai is recalling 82,000 electric cars internationally to replace batteries in their vehicles after 15 reports of fires involving their vehicles. Hyundai’s recall will be one of the most expensive car recalls in history.

The recall will cost Hyundai over $900 million total with the average cost per vehicle at $11,000.

Replacing an entire battery is an extreme measure, requiring a similar amount of work and expense as replacing an entire engine of a gas-powered car.

The actual cost of the recall is not available because most car manufacturers do not release that exact information.
